Blake Hatfield, PGA Sales Representative for Cutter & Buck, defeated Benji Williams, PGA, Head Golf Coach at Mississippi University of Women & Cory Cooper, PGA, Director of Golf at The Country Club of Jackson, to win the first Gulf States PGA Stroke Play series event of the year at Laurel Country Club. Blake shot a steady, even par 72, with Williams & Cooper finishing one stroke behind him with a 1-over par 73. Congratulations to Blake on the win!
